So what‘s really going on here ? Is it other than WA and Conrad, the rest of them become C&E and Neutrogena ? Hilton and DT share C&E, ES, HGI, HI, HS, Home2 are all Neutrogena, i remember ES was used to be Giovanni organic stuff but it is gone to Neutrogena as well.

Also not too enamoured with the new E & C bath amenities. I'll still use them but hope they change again sooner rather than later. I find two issues with the E & C items:

1) the bottles are poor design, they don't seal well and can be hard to open initially sometimes
2) they don't 'pour' well, so you end up with too little or too much and they therefore don't last nearly as long/well as the PTR tubes did IMO.

I certainly don't take them home with me like I did the PTR items.
